The dye is Islam. The religion was metaphorically called a dye because its effects and characteristics become apparent on the religious person, just as the effect of dye appears on a garment. It was said that it is the nature of Allah (fitrat Allah) or the way of Allah (sunnat Allah). It was also said to be circumcision. It was also said that when Christians have a child, they immerse him in yellow water to purify him, so Allah informed them that His religion is Islam, not what the Christians do.
